RECREATIONAL AVIATION FOUNDATION RYAN FIELD AIRSTRIP ANNOUNCEMENT

Adjacent to the towering mountains of Glacier National Park lies a recreational airstrip that will soon be available for the enjoyment by capable pilots with suitable aircraft. The Recreational Aviation Foundation (RAF) announces that Ryan Field, near West Glacier, Montana, (Great Falls Sectional Chart) will be open in the summer of 2009 for general use…

FLYING LOSES A REAL ADVOCATE

We are profoundly saddened to report that Sparky Imeson of Helena, Montana, formerly of Jackson Hole, WY, perished in an aviation accident Tuesday, March 17 after departing Bozeman solo in his Cessna 180 on a routine 70-mile flight to Helena. Helena’s daily Independent Record reported that the wreckage was located by search crews from Malmstrom…

NEW LANDING STRIP IN LEWIS AND CLARK NATIONAL FOREST!

Four years spent cooperating with the US Forest Service, planning, building trust and credibility has resulted in a new site for a recreational airstrip in the beautiful Russian Flat of central Montana, a short walk from the south fork of the Judith River where anglers enjoy catch-and-release fishing. BOZEMAN PILOT SHELTER IS COMPLETED!

The RAF worked with the Bozeman, Montana Airport Authority in constructing a new pilot shelter at the BZN airport. The building can be used by local pilots and transient campers. Submitted on August 23, 2007.

MONTANA PRIVATE AIRPORTS GET PROTECTION FROM NEW STATE LAW!

In April of 2007 Montana Governor Brian Schweitzer signed into law Senate Bill 318. This new law provides a measure of protection for private airstrip owners who don’t charge the public to use their airstrips for recreational purposes.
